Like I said, I looted and sold nearly everything (except for heavy armors worth couple of gold each) -- and that only amounted to about 500K in total. I think I had about 300K by the time the tournament started.
2 High perception characters, 2 High Trickery and then grab everything. (Armags Tomb for e.x before the tournament has several items worth up to 200k each but theyve got perception dcs of 35+). Also every magical item that wasnt needed on my main 6 guys, just sell it. Didnt eq the other Characters much.
